For the last few weeks, it has been heavily rumored that Samantha is planning to shift her base to Mumbai and focus on Bollywood. The rumors started when she amassed huge fame with her performance in The Family Man season 2.
The speculations further intensified when she announced separation from her husband Naga Chaitanya. However, the Majili actress cleared all the rumors and clarified that she belongs to Telugu cinema and it is her home.
According to a Times of India report, when a fan asked about her experience of working in southern and northern film industries, Samantha said, “Am I really a part of the ‘northern’ film industry? The Telugu film industry is home to me.”
“Hyderabad will always be home. And the people here will always have a special place in my heart,” Samantha further added.

The 34-year-old actress will be soon seen in the Tamil film Kathu Vaakula Rendu Kaadhal.
In Telugu, she will be next seen in the mythological epic Shaakuntalam, which is being directed by Gunashekhar. She is also doing a special song in Allu Arjun’s upcoming film Pushpa.
